Building Security Officer (Full-Time, Graveyard)
sphere entertainment
Job Summary
The Building Security Officer at Sphere Entertainment Co. ensures a safe and secure environment by staffing 24/7 security posts, controlling access, screening visitors and equipment, and observing/reporting security threats. Responsibilities include assisting with guest ingress/egress, screening bulk items, escorting personnel, and executing arena security response and evacuation plans.

Special Requirements
- Responsibilities also include but are not limited to radio usage, operation of specialized equipment (bollards, etc), placement and relocation of barriers, wayfinding, crowd management, conflict resolution, access control, personnel contraband/weapons screening and VIP escort/support.
- May be exposed to theatrical smoke, strobe lights, pyrotechnics, intense sound, rapid motion video effects, smoke, and odors
- May be deployed to outdoor posts that may be exposed to triple-digit temperatures, UV rays, high winds, or monsoon weather. Appropriate hydration, PPE, and sun protection will be provided.
- May have outdoor and UV exposure
- Must be able to successfully complete physical fitness examination.
- Ability to work a flexible schedule including nights, have split days off, work weekends and holidays in a 24 X 7 environment
- General physical requirements such as lifting up to 25 lbs., standing for long periods, walking long distances, bending and constant motion is often required.
- Certifications:
- Nevada Alcohol Awareness (TAM) Card
- Sheriff’s Card
